Faulkner Co. Administrator Pleads Not Guilty to Theft
By: Lauren Trager, KARK 4 News
Updated: August 29, 2012
County Administrator Jeff Johnston pleaded not guilty after being charged with stealing approximately $4,000 worth of asphalt in 2008.
A prosecutor says he used blacktop paid for by the county to pave his own driveway in Mount Vernon, but Johnston told a judge he wasn't guilty.
A trial date was set for October.
